Hi, if you didn't mess with the settings within WinRAR (Options => Settings => separator Paths => Folder for temporary files = C:\Windows\Temp\) that's where you'll find your ISO in a folder called Rar$ +anything.

Did it a while ago and found my ISO @ C:\Windows\Temp\Rar$DIa1012.2690 but as soon as I closed WinRAR that (TEMP) folder disappear
